    Not sure about this update as my system is running Directx 10.1 just had a closer look this info from microsoft might help
    To check which version of DirectX is on your computer


    1. Open DirectX Diagnostic Tool by clicking the Start button , typing dxdiag in the search box, and then pressing Enter.
    2. Click the System tab, and then, under System Information, check the DirectX version number.

    Strangely my Navidia control center reports Directx 10.1 but using the above routine it tells me I'm running DirectX 11.
    Procede with caution me thinks
